Here's the plot: "Hear the inside story of Huey Newton and the Black Panthers with this documentary that examines their efforts to promote the rights of African Americans as well as the organizations violent tactics including the killing of a police officer The film features a rare jailhouse interview with Newton discussing the role of revolution and civil disobedience plus footage of several Panthers bulletriddled homes following police raids"
